Most people know Bowen this French brand maybe from another name, the famous English shoemaker Alfred Sargent. Bowen only focuses the local market and almost occupied more than 90% production capacity of Alfred Sargent. Very few French shoe brands use English shoemaker. The Chinese is 青山闲居, the founder and master shoemaker, Mr. WANG Zhencheng showed his skills on this pair of Shell Cordovan Seamless Wholecut Oxfords. The shoes are almost fully handmade with handwelted and handstitched for 250 USD, and leathers are from great tanneries such as Ilcea Italy and Weinheimer Germany. Post Views: 1,475
